|
||||
**Scene Workspaces** creates an alternative workspaces topbar, allowing you to filter and reorder workspaces, scene by scene.
|
||||
|
||||
Basically, you can decide which workspace you want to link to each scene.
|
||||
|
||||
> Scene Workspaces is based on simple custom properties at scene level.
|
||||
|
||||
Scene Workspaces can be particularly useful in projects with multiple scenes with different needs/purpose.
|
||||
|
||||
### Make yourself comfortable
|
||||
|
||||
You can customize Scene Workspaces from add-on preferences:
|
||||
|
||||
- **Show only with multiple scenes** *(default: off)*
|
||||
*Show the topbar (and eventually the checkbox) only when the project has multiple scenes.
|
||||
Basically, Scene Workspaces disappear as long as you have one scene only.*
|
||||
- **Auto initialize Scene Workspaces** *(default: on)*
|
||||
*Automatically add all available workspaces to the current scene, if empty.
|
||||
If available workspaces match one of the 5 default templates, they will be automatically ordered on initialization. Otherwise, workspaces will be ordered alphabetically.*
|
||||
- **Show Checkbox** *(default: on)*
|
||||
*When active, shows a checkbox to switch between Scene Workspaces and the default topbar.*
|
||||
*This checkbox will directly affect the next preference.*
|
||||
- **Use Scene Workspaces topbar** *(default: on)*
|
||||
*Switch between Scene Workspaces topbar and the default topbar.*
|
||||
- **Use Compact Mode** *(default: on)*
|
||||
*Also avaliable from the workspace menu.*
|
||||
*Compact Mode ON*
|
||||

|
||||
*Compact Mode OFF*
|
||||

|
||||
|

### Topbar menus
|
||||
|
||||
What you can usually to do by right-clicking on a workspace (and more) it's avaliable by clicking the near options button.
|
||||
|
||||
The first options are the ones from Scene Workspaces:
|
||||
|
||||
- **Toggle Compact Mode** *(preference)*
|
||||
- **Unlink workspace from scene**
|
||||
- **Rename** *(for all scenes)*
|
||||
- **Reorder to front** *(only for this scene)*
|
||||
- **Move left** *(only for this scene)*
|
||||
- **Move right** *(only for this scene)*
|
||||
- **Reorder to back** *(only for this scene)*
|
||||
- **Previous workspace** *(using scene order) `Shift + Ctrl + Page Up`*
|
||||
- **Next Workspace** *(using scene order) `Shift + Ctrl + Page Down`*
|
||||
|
||||
> **Note**
|
||||
> Default options like `Reorder to Front`, `Reorder to Back` will only affect the global workspaces, and not the Scene Workspaces topbar.
|
||||
> *Instead, use the ones marked with `(scene only)` or use the panel instead.*
|
||||
>
|
||||
> Also, default options `Previous Workspace` and `Next Workspace` will follow the global workspaces order, and not the scene order.
|
||||
> *Instead, use the ones marked with `(scene)` or the relative shortcuts (default ones + Shift).*
|
||||
|

## Why this add-on?
|
||||
|
||||
In Blender, workspaces are common across scenes.
|
||||
|
||||
At the same time, you may need different workspaces in different scenes, depending on the purpose of the scene.
|
||||
|
||||
*For example, you may want a scene with workspaces optimized for modelling and another Scene optimized for Video Editing, in the same project.*
|
||||
|
||||
**Scene Workspaces** make this possible with the custom topbar and a custom property for each scene.
|
